In this episode, Matthew Masters is joined by Cathy Palmer, Director of Regeneration Delivery at Walker Sime, to explore the critical ingredients that determine whether a masterplan succeeds or fails. With a career spanning both local government and consultancy, Cathy brings a rare dual perspective to the conversation. Her work at Walker Sime, particularly through the Regen Delivery service, focuses on helping councils and developers move from vision to viable delivery in complex regeneration projects.

Cathy’s insights are grounded in real-world experience, having led major regeneration initiatives across the UK. She understands the internal workings of councils, the pressures of political cycles, and the importance of community trust. Her team at Walker Sime acts as a bridge between public and private sectors, offering strategic support in everything from bid leadership to delivery route planning.
